#60e566 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#60e566 is composed of 37.6% red, 89.8%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 55.5%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 122.7 degrees, a saturation of 71.9% and a lightness of 63.7%. #60e566 color hex could be obtained by blending #c0ffcc with #00cb00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#60e566 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#60e566 has RGB values of R:96, G:229, B:102 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0, Y:0.55,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 6350182.
